How they compare

Republic of Moldova currently reports 4.63 % change on previous year against 4.54 % change on previous year in Korea, a difference of 0.09 % change on previous year.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 23 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Republic of Moldova ahead.

Korea ranks 66th and Republic of Moldova ranks 64th of 197 countries.

Republic of Moldova has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
